Understanding Green Sports Day and Celebrating Sustainability in Sports
Green Sports Day, launched by the Green Sports Alliance in 2016, unites the global sports community in recognition of its potential to advance climate action and environmental stewardship. With support from teams, athletes, and fans, the initiative raises awareness of how sports organizations can safeguard a healthy planet for future generations by incorporating leadership in sustainability.
Each year, Green Sports Day emphasizes action. Teams and venues commit to sustainable practices such as reducing energy use, eliminating single-use plastics, and investing in renewable energy. Athletes and fans amplify these efforts by participating in awareness campaigns, sustainability pledges, and community service initiatives. This collective movement demonstrates that sports have the power not only to entertain but also to inspire a sustainable future.

Why it Matters
The sports industry has a significant environmental footprint. Sports venue sustainability is critical, as stadiums and arenas consume vast amounts of energy and water, generate substantial waste, and require extensive transportation logistics. With climate challenges becoming more frequent and severe, integrating climate action into sports reduces risks to operations, supply chains, and community resilience. Green Sports Day emphasizes climate action in sports by showcasing how teams and venues can reduce emissions and inspire fans.
Environmental sustainability in sports is no longer optional, and integrating sustainability into sports operations is not only about reducing negative impacts but also essential for long-term viability. By embracing climate action in sports, organizations can:
- Reduce greenhouse gas emissions and energy costs
- Build resilient infrastructure to withstand climate impacts
- Strengthen community engagement and trust
- Inspire fans to adopt sustainable behaviors
- Align with emerging regulations and sustainability standards
- Adopt renewable energy and water reuse technologies
Sports are uniquely positioned to model solutions at scale. When a major league team adopts renewable energy or a university athletic program implements zero-waste initiatives, the impact extends far beyond the field.
Advancing Sustainability in Sports
SSI gives sports venues the tools to identify opportunities to become industry leaders in sustainability. SSI is the first-of-its-kind annual survey and benchmarking report analyzing the environmental and social practices of professional, minor league, and collegiate sports venues. Using anonymized, self-reported data, SSI provides an industry-wide snapshot of progress while equipping organizations with insights to strengthen their sustainability strategies.
Now in its fifth year, SSI continues to highlight how venues are embedding sustainability into their operations. Each year, our SSI Benchmarking Report features case studies, highlights industry leaders, and shares best practices to inspire collective progress. Participation is open to all venues, regardless of where they are on their sustainability journey. By participating in SSI, sports organizations gain access to anonymized benchmarking, actionable insights, and a platform that advances sustainability initiatives, community engagement, and more.
While Green Sports Day raises visibility, SSI ensures accountability and continuous improvement.
For example, recent SSI findings have revealed that:
- 86% of venues report having a sponsor for sustainability programs
- 55% of venues conduct annual staff training
- 28% of venues generate onsite renewable energy
Sustainability Strategies for Sports Organizations
Sports organizations looking to maximize their impact on Green Sports Day and beyond can leverage SSI findings to guide their sustainability strategies.
Recommended actions include:
- Set measurable goals: Establish targets for energy, water, waste, and greenhouse gas reductions.
- Engage fans: Use sporting events to educate and inspire fans to adopt sustainable behaviors.
- Invest in infrastructure: Prioritize renewable energy, efficient lighting, water reuse, and resilient construction.
- Collaborate across the industry: Share data, case studies, and lessons learned through tools like SSI.
